Hey I'm Scott from Ontario Canada licensed electrician/automation specialist have been reefing for about 6-1/2 years. Just recently lost a 180g setup due to leak in the seal. Well building a new system a custom Miracles 72Lx24Hx30D with Starphire Glass on 3 sides with a ReefSavvy ghost overflow. For lighting I've decided on the Aqua Illumination 52HD, Apex Fusion with flow module, Ecotech MP40QD and a Sunpole pump. The back of the aquarium will be recessed 1/2" into the wall with eclosed base and custom canopy mounted to ceiling with acess. Plus the aquarium will have access from rear mechanical room.
